CVE-2019-5765
Dashboard / Vulnerabilities / CVE-2019-5765
CVE-2019-5765
Summary:
Details: An exposed debugging endpoint in the browser in Google Chrome on Android prior to 72.0.3626.81 allowed a local attacker to obtain potentially sensitive information from process memory via a crafted Intent.
